2016年4月26日

Asp.net MVC 4 异步方法

摘要: 今天我们来看一下,同样功能在 Asp.net MVC 4 下的实现,基于.net framework 4.5 下的async支持,让我们的代码更加简单,看下面片断代码名叫Index的Action方法: public async Task<ActionResult> IndexAsync() { va 阅读全文

posted @ 2016-04-26 23:28 大西瓜3721 阅读(275) 评论(0) 推荐(0)

Ioc容器Autofac系列(3)-- 三种注册组件的方式

摘要: 简单来说,所谓注册组件,就是注册类并映射为接口,然后根据接口获取对应类,Autofac将被注册的类称为组件。 虽然可像上篇提到的一次性注册程序集中所有类,但AutoFac使用最多的还是单个注册。这种注册共有三种方式,其中最简单的就是用As方法,例如,ArrayList继承了IEnumerable接口 阅读全文

posted @ 2016-04-26 23:16 大西瓜3721 阅读(228) 评论(0) 推荐(0)

随心所欲的DateTime显示格式

摘要: 任何项目,难免会碰到DateTime的显示问题,.net框架虽提供丰富多样的显示方法,但我很少使用,因老忘记细节,每次都要纠结到底月份在前还是年份在前;日期分隔符到底是“/”,还是“\”,还是“-”等等。 因此,每逢日期显示,我的写法通常类似下面代码所示,这样能根据需求取舍,随心所欲的控制显示格式、 阅读全文

posted @ 2016-04-26 23:15 大西瓜3721 阅读(376) 评论(0) 推荐(0)

Ioc容器Autofac系列(2)-- asp.net mvc中整合autofac

摘要: 创建Asp.net MVC并引入Autofac 首先,创建一个MVC站点,为方便起见,选初始带HomeController和AccountController的那种。然后通过NuGet或到Autofac官网下载来引入类库。个人推荐前者,因为从VS2010开始,已内集可视化的NuGet功能,使用起来非 阅读全文

posted @ 2016-04-26 23:13 大西瓜3721 阅读(281) 评论(0) 推荐(0)

Ioc容器Autofac系列(1)-- 初窥

摘要: 前言 第一次接触Autofac是因为CMS系统--Orchard,后来在一个开源爬虫系统--NCrawler中也碰到过,随着深入了解,我越发觉得Ioc容器是Web开发中必不可少的利器。那么,Ioc容器是用来做什么的?用了有什么好处?我相信如果不明白这两点就很难敞开心扉接受Ioc容器。 传统解耦设计的 阅读全文

posted @ 2016-04-26 23:05 大西瓜3721 阅读(280) 评论(0) 推荐(0)

nopcommerce商城系统--源代码结构和架构

摘要: 这个文档是让开发者了解nopcommerce解决方案结构的指南。这是新的nopcommerce开发者学习nopcommerce代码的相关文档。首先,nopCommerce源代码是很容易得到的。它是一个开源应用程序,因此,所有你只要从代码托管完整下载它就行了。在你打开VS以后项目和文件夹都会完整列出来 阅读全文

posted @ 2016-04-26 23:01 大西瓜3721 阅读(468) 评论(0) 推荐(0)

nopcommerce商城系统--如何编写一个插件

摘要: 插件是用来扩展nopCommerce功能的。nopCommerce拥有多种类型的插件。例如:支付方式(PayPal),税务机构,送货方式计算方法(UPS, USP, FedEx),小部件(如“在线聊天”块)等等。 nopCommerce本身也自带了很多不同的插件。您还可以在nopCommerce官方 阅读全文

posted @ 2016-04-26 23:00 大西瓜3721 阅读(321) 评论(0) 推荐(0)

ASP.NET MVC:通过 FileResult 向 浏览器 发送文件

摘要: 在 Controller 中我们可以使用 FileResult 向客户端发送文件。 FileResult FileResult 是一个抽象类,继承自 ActionResult。在 System.Web.Mvc.dll 中,它有如上三个子类,分别以不同的方式向客户端发送文件。 在实际使用中我们通常不需 阅读全文

posted @ 2016-04-26 15:34 大西瓜3721 阅读(532) 评论(0) 推荐(0)

导航